£16.15 per hour

Location: Scotstoun, Glasgow, Scotland

Working hours: 38 hours per week - 5 days per week (Monday to Sunday) (Hours allocated in advance on a shift / rota basis)

Who are we?

First Bus - one of the UK’s largest bus operators, passionate about delivering passenger journeys that are sustainable, comfortable, and efficient!

How to prepare for a job interview at Firstbus

✨Know Your Routes

Familiarise yourself with the local routes and key landmarks in Glasgow. Being able to discuss your knowledge of the area during the interview will show your commitment and readiness for the role.

✨Safety First

Brush up on your understanding of safety regulations and best practices for bus driving. Be prepared to discuss how you prioritise passenger safety and what measures you take to ensure a secure journey.

✨Customer Service Skills

Think about examples from your past experiences where you provided excellent customer service. First Bus values a friendly and efficient approach, so be ready to share how you handle difficult situations with passengers.

✨Dress the Part

Even though it’s a driving position, first impressions matter! Dress smartly for your interview to convey professionalism and respect for the role you’re applying for.
